From AFP:
The Gaza Strip's Hamas government said on Tuesday it had added studies to encourage "resistance to Israel" to the territory's public schools curriculum.

Courses to "strengthen Palestinian rights, update programs and add studies on human rights" would be introduced at three levels in secondary schools, Education Minister Muetassem al-Minaui told Agence France Presse.

They were intended to instill "faith in the role of the resistance to win rights and to raise awareness of the importance of effective preparations to face the enemy," he said.

The new material, seen by AFP, tells of Israel's winter 2008-2009 and November 2012 military offensives into the Gaza Strip and shows photos of dead Palestinians and of buildings destroyed by Israeli strikes.

"All of Palestine from the (Mediterranean) sea to the river (Jordan) belongs to us, to us Muslims," it states, in accordance with the beliefs of the militant Islamic group, which refuses to recognize Israel.

The new courses will be taught only in education ministry schools and not those of the United Nations Relief and Works agency, in which close to half of the 463,000 pupils in the strip study, the agency's operations director Robert Turner told journalists on Tuesday.

At the start of this year, Hamas launched an experimental program of basic military training for about 10,000 high school students.
Besides the obvious (support for terror, denial of Jewish rights), this shows that Hamas never had any intention to provide Christians with equal rights under their political system. They are saying that "Palestine belongs to us Muslims" only. Christians are merely tolerated if they act like good little dhimmis and stay in their place.

Then again, anyone who ever read Hamas' charter knows that they are anti-Christian:
From time to time a clamoring is voiced, to hold an International Conference in search for a solution to the problem. ...The Islamic Resistance Movement...does not believe that those conferences are capable of responding to demands, or of restoring rights or doing justice to the oppressed. Those conferences are no more than a means to appoint the nonbelievers as arbitrators in the lands of Islam. Since when did the Unbelievers do justice to the Believers? “And the Jews will not be pleased with thee, nor will the Christians, till thou follow their creed. Say: Lo! the guidance of Allah [himself] is the Guidance. And if you should follow their desires after the knowledge which has come unto thee, then you would have from Allah no protecting friend nor helper.” Sura 2 (the Cow), verse 120. There is no solution to the Palestinian problem except by Jihad.

...Under the shadow of Islam it is possible for the members of the three religions: Islam, Christianity and Judaism to coexist in safety and security. Safety and security can only prevail under the shadow of Islam
.There are a few Christians left in Gaza. They have already been discriminated against, attacked, kidnapped, vandalized, and forced to convert. For some reason no one seems to spend too much time on the anti-Christian bigotry in Gaza.

And now that bigotry is being taught in schools.
